What it's like to be an Aircraft Mechanic

The profession of an aircraft mechanic is challenging and essential for aviation safety. These professionals are responsible for maintaining and repairing aircraft, ensuring that they are in safe operating condition.
Important aspects of the profession:

Preventative Maintenance: Regular inspection of aircraft to identify and correct problems before they become critical.

Repairs: Assess, remove, repair and replace defective or worn parts.

Tests: Perform performance tests on aircraft systems.

Records: Keep detailed records of all inspections, maintenance and repairs performed.

Safety: Ensure that all aviation safety standards and regulations are strictly followed.

Technical Knowledge: In-depth understanding of aircraft mechanical, electrical and electronic systems.

Problem Diagnosis: Ability to identify and solve complex problems.

Education: Technical courses or training programs in aircraft maintenance offered by aviation schools or technical institutes.

EASA Certification: Certification is regulated by the European Aviation Safety Agency (EASA). In Portugal, it is necessary to obtain the Aircraft Maintenance Technician License (LMA) Part 66, which is divided into several categories (A, B1, B2, C, etc.).

Category A: Line maintenance (routine maintenance activities)

Category B1: Mechanic (mechanical maintenance).

Category B2: Avionics (electrical and electronic systems).

Category C: Basic maintenance (maintenance planning and management).

Constant Update: Aviation is a constantly evolving field, requiring mechanics to stay up to date with new methods and technologies.

Hangars and Workshops: Most work is performed in maintenance hangars or workshops.

Flexible schedules: Mechanics often work shifts, including nights, weekends and holidays, due to the non-stop nature of aviation.

Challenges: Working under pressure to meet deadlines, especially in commercial airlines where aircraft downtime must be minimized. Responsibility for flight safety is also a stressful factor.

Rewards: The satisfaction of ensuring the safety of passengers and crew, plus good career opportunities and competitive salaries for those with experience and certifications.

Career Advancement: With experience, aircraft mechanics can advance to supervisory positions, maintenance management, or specialization in specific areas.

Recruitment: The demand for aircraft mechanics is high and constant in the global job market, given the growing aviation industry, the introduction of new aircraft technologies, and the continuous need for maintenance.

In short, being an aircraft mechanic requires a strong commitment to safety, accuracy and responsibility, as well as a solid foundation of technical knowledge and practical skills. It is a profession that offers both challenges and significant financial rewards.

An aircraft mechanic with EASA certification can work in all European countries, and also in other continents via a conversion of his license to the local regulatory body.
